Part 1 of Stephen's interview with Sir Paul McCartney finds the legendary musician musing on his favorite cover performances of songs by The Beatles, including Marvin Gaye's take on "Yesterday" and that time BTS riffed on "Hey Jude" right here on The Late Show. #Colbert #Beatles #PaulMcCartney

Irrelevant fun fact. In south Korea in the 90's students would sing hey Jude as the last song in a karaoke, because it's like the longest song and even if your time is up they had to let you finish the last song. If you could start hey Jude just before the last minute it felt like you had beaten the system
